10 tips for beginner travelers-shoppers

In her previous travel column, Zhanna Badoeva already told SPLETNIK.RU readers about the most unusual beauty procedures and tools from around the world, today the TV presenter shares tips with novice travelers-shoppers. We read and take note!

Zhanna Badoeva
  1. Do not take all the savings on yourfirst shopping trip. There is a chance to buy everything, but not what you need. Let your budget be limited. For the first trip, for example, to Europe, 2,000 dollars or euros are enough.
  2. Be sure to read all the shopping guides, recommendations of friends and acquaintances before traveling to a specific country.
  3. Before you buy something, ask yourself the question, do you really need this thing, how much you need it and why. Need - buy! Doubt it? Leave the purchase for later. So to say, "sleep" with a future purchase.
  4. One of the best places for shopping is outlets. They are in almost every country. Both the mass market brands and the famous luxury brands at very affordable prices are concentrated there. Outlets are usually located outside the city, so you have to spend time on the road, but it's worth it.
  5. Arriving at your destination, do the so-called "Market Survey." See what of the suggested stores / items / brands to choose from. Go around all the stores presented, try on, take time to "think" and the next day go buy.
  6. Communicate more with the locals. You can always ask them where to find good and inexpensive stores with clothes or accessories from local designers, where markets or antique collapses are concentrated.
  7. Local designers in every country - yours! The brands are little-known, the prices are reasonable, but the option to meet a friend in exactly the same clothes is zero. Do not chase brands, rely on exclusivity.
  8. Spend no more than two hours a day on shopping. Otherwise, the eye begins to blur, fatigue and a desire to buy everything appear. The next morning, when you see countless packages of things that you do not need, you will regret it.
  9. It is important to buy things when there is an understanding of what and how you will wear them (shoes, bag, accessories).
  10. Do not buy what you saw at fashion shows, in magazines or on star models, because even if it is a very fashionable thing, it may not be yours. And you will not look stylish, but funny.
